Output 81c86033450fb6a924bc66fe7e9a02a31ebe925819f2990fec5eaf7a6729ea1a:0

value
22254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7ee9c57fa498986df4cb7918225a240cbcce8f9 OP_EQUAL
address
3NqMrpWKStvT1GeMFaRDCgM5uKERTCtZLb
transaction
81c86033450fb6a924bc66fe7e9a02a31ebe925819f2990fec5eaf7a6729ea1a
spent
true